For our nurses: If Lamar is in a medically induced coma, how could he say "good morning"?

There are times when a neurologist will reduce the amount of sedation in a patient to be able to assess the patients level of function.
From what I've read, Lamar is no longer intubated and breathing on his own with only supplemental oxygen which is a good sign. That being said, we really can't be sure of any of this as we've yet to hear from his medical caregivers.

Prior to 2009 Heidi Fleiss was talking about opening up a men's bordello for women in Nye County. She lives in Pahrump.

http://www.reviewjournal.com/news/heidi-fleiss-gives-plan-brothel-women

The Hollywood Madam turned Pahrump laundromat owner says she's abandoning her plans to open a Nye County brothel catering to women. With its stable of men, Heidi's Stud Farm would have been the first bordello of its kind in Nevada, where houses of prostitution are legal in most rural counties.

Fleiss first announced her plans in late 2005. A short time later she rented a house in Pahrump and teamed with her brother, Jesse, to buy 60 acres in the tiny nearby town of Crystal.
